Three Things To Know Before Betting On Lakers vs. Warriors

1. Head-To-Head

The Warriors were 3-1 in four games played against the Lakers last year, but Los Angeles did cover the spread in two of those games. Even with those covers for the Lakers, the Warriors are 3-2 ATS in the last five meetings between these teams. But it's a little hard to factor in head-to-head history with these two franchises both having some down years in recent seasons. It's more important to look at the on-court matchups.

2. New signings

The Lakers actually made some really nice improvements this offseason, bringing in Patrick Beverley, Lonnie Walker IV, Dennis Schroder and Thomas Bryant. The last two players are out for this game, but Beverley and Walker look like two guys that should fit in really nicely next to LeBron James and Anthony Davis. Also, Beverley's tenacity on the defensive end will stand out in a game like this. He'll pick Stephen Curry up from full court in this one. That won't mean that Curry will get shut down or anything, but he could be a little tired late in the game. That's something to consider if this one is close in the end — which it could very well be.

3. Draymond vs. Poole

The Warriors are the defending champions and arguably got better with their offseason acquisitions. However, Golden State has a lot to figure out when it comes to chemistry, as we all know that Draymond Green nearly knocked Jordan Poole out in practice last week. It'll be interesting to see if there are any lingering on-court effects from that situation. The Chase Center will be rocking for this game, but will the classic Warriors vibes be there on the court? These guys might hate each other right now.
